Key Factors to Consider When Choosing Comfortable Loafers

1. Material

The material plays a pivotal role in determining the comfort and durability of your loafers. Opt for breathable and supple materials, such as genuine leather, suede, or canvas. These fabrics conform to the shape of your foot, minimizing friction and ensuring a snug fit.

2. Fit

Proper fit is essential for maximizing comfort. Loafers should fit snugly but not constrictingly. Ensure there is ample wiggle room for your toes while avoiding excessive space that could cause your feet to slip and slide.

3. Sole

The sole of your loafers should provide adequate support and cushioning. Look for loafers with padded insoles and flexible outsoles that absorb shock and reduce fatigue during prolonged periods of wear.

4. Heel Height

For maximum comfort, choose loafers with a low heel of around 1-2 inches. This provides elevation without compromising stability or comfort.

Effective Strategies for Finding the Perfect Pair of Comfortable Loafers

  • Visit a Reputable Shoe Store: Seek the expertise of a knowledgeable salesperson who can measure your feet and assist you in selecting the most comfortable and appropriate loafers.

  • Read Customer Reviews: Consult online reviews to gain insights from other customers who have purchased and worn the loafers you're considering.

  • Consider Orthotics: If you have any specific foot problems, consider using orthotics to further enhance comfort and support.

  • Break In Gradually: Wear your new loafers for short periods initially and gradually increase the duration as they adjust to your feet.

Tips and Tricks for Enhancing Comfort

  • Apply Leather Conditioner: Regularly apply a leather conditioner to keep your loafers supple and prevent cracking.

  • Use Shoe Trees: Insert shoe trees into your loafers when not in use to maintain their shape and absorb moisture.

  • Choose Socks Wisely: Wear moisture-wicking socks to prevent sweating and reduce friction.

  • Stretch the Toe Box: If your loafers are slightly tight in the toe box, use a shoe stretcher to gently widen it.

  • Add a Heel Cushion: For extra cushioning, place a heel cushion inside your loafers to absorb shock and reduce heel pain.

Step-by-Step Approach to Finding Comfortable Loafers

  1. Measure Your Feet: Determine the length and width of your feet using a Brannock device or a similar measuring tool.

  2. Determine Your Fit: Identify the appropriate width and size for your feet. Loafers should fit snugly but not constrictingly.

  3. Research Different Materials: Explore the various materials available, such as genuine leather, suede, and canvas, and choose the one that best meets your needs.

  4. Try On Multiple Styles: Visit a shoe store and try on different styles of loafers to find the one that is most comfortable and complements your outfit preferences.

  5. Wear for a Test Drive: Walk around the store wearing the loafers for several minutes to assess their comfort and support.

  6. Consider Orthotics: If necessary, discuss the use of orthotics with a knowledgeable salesperson or podiatrist to enhance comfort.

  7. Make an Informed Decision: After careful consideration, make your purchase decision and enjoy the comfort and style of your new loafers.

Table 1: Comparison of Materials for Comfortable Loafers

Material Benefits Drawbacks
Genuine Leather Durable, breathable, conforms to the foot Can be expensive, requires care
Suede Soft, luxurious, flexible May stain easily, requires regular maintenance
Canvas Breathable, lightweight, affordable Not as durable as leather or suede
